Lukas Mai did his master’s thesis in 2020 in the field of photocatalysis at this group. His doctoral research continues in the same field within the mechanistic investigation of Ir(III), Co(III) complexes and Nanodots as efficient catalysts for triplet-triplet energy transfer photocatalysis in organic reactions, where he cooperates closely with the Glorius Group at WWU Münster.
